Lukas 22:29-31
Orthodox Jewish Bible
29 And I assign shlita (authority) to you, just as Avi assigned shlita to me; a Malchut (Kingdom),
30 That you may eat and drink at my tish in my Malchut, and you will sit upon kissot (thrones) judging the Shneym Asar Shivtei Yisroel (Twelve Tribes of Yisroel).
31 Shimon, Shimon, hinei, Hasatan asked for you, to sift you like wheat [IYOV 1:6-12; AMOS 9:9]
